Lizzy changes her stage name to Park Soo-Ah and officially begins her career as an actress!

On July 3, Celltrion Entertainment reported that Park Soo-Ah (formally known as Lizzy from After School) confirmed to join the cast of upcoming web drama “I Picked Up a Celebrity on the street” (literal translation).

Park Soo-Ah will take on the role of Jin Se-Ra, an actress in the same agency as male lead character. In the drama, the actress gets involved in a mysterious incident with Kang Jun-Hyuk, but continues to show off her lovely charms as they try to escape the situation. Furthermore, with her unique bubbly characteristic, Jin Se-Ra will create the comical atmosphere this drama intends to deliver.

Celltrion said, “the healthy and active image that Park Soo-Ah has in real life matched the character 100%. Thus, the production team had unanimously decided to cast her. Park Soo-Ah plans to transfer her real life characteristic into the character in drama. We hope you look forward to it.”

Park Soo-Ah acted in many dramas while promoting as a member of After School. She started with sitcom “All My Love For You” in 2011, and continued with 2012 “Rascal Sons” and “Angry Mom” in 2015. Throughout the works, the actress proved herself as one of the rare multi-entertainers in the industry.

Meanwhile, “I Picked Up a Celebrity on the Street” will tell a story about a woman, who accidentally “picks up” a global star on the street. Previously, Sung Hoon confirmed to take on the role of Kang Jun-Hyuk, the celebrity who ends up a hostage at a mysterious house. The drama will become availble through a video streaming platform Oksusu in September.
